In 2025, Black Friday has evolved from a single-day shopping frenzy into a five-day event, stretching from Thanksgiving through Cyber Monday, with nearly 200 million Americans participating and spending an average of $235 each last year. However, with economic uncertainties and tighter household budgets, consumers are increasingly seeking smarter, more sustainable ways to shop. This shift is driven by a growing awareness of overconsumption’s environmental impact, the rise of digital shopping alternatives, and a desire to support local businesses during Small Business Saturday. Additionally, the concept of “Buy Nothing Day,” initiated in 1992 by activist groups, has gained renewed momentum as consumers prioritize mindful spending and minimalism. Experts now recommend strategic planning, comparison shopping, and embracing eco-friendly products to maximize value and reduce waste. As retailers adapt, many are offering extended deals, exclusive online discounts, and eco-conscious product lines to attract savvy shoppers.
